However I’m very hesitant on this one. What made Walking with dinosaurs special is 3 things:
1. Drama. While the animals in the original series were portrayed realistically at the time, there was also an underlying dramatic narrative of sorts. It wasn’t just “Dino eats, Dino mates, etc etc.” it had drama, it gave them a sense of purpose, like “Dino must find their way to the north to get a mate, however it must survive the trials and tribulations along the way.”
2. Music. The orchestral music in WWD was PEAK
3. Practical effects. The original WWD used a mixture of CGI and practical effects. Like there would be an actual modeled foot or head of the dinosaur in the close up shots. It gave it this unique feeling and the people who worked on the puppetry/animatronics were talented beyond measure.
I’m only going to watch it if it has practical effects and music. I can go without the dramatic narratives that the original WED had, but leaving out the music and practical effects is a dealbreaker.

I hope the modern day segments are at the end of the episodes. Something along the lines of 'you've seen the episode, here's the evidence to back up what we showed you'.
I think I will enjoy having paleontologists pop in periodically during the episode to explain some of the science behind the depictions. Prehistoric Planet went the "full immersion" route, which I think worked wonderfully, but it left something to be desired for the nerds like me who are always wondering how we know what we know (i.e., what behaviors does the fossil record provide evidence for, what are we making inferences about and what evidence informs those inferences, etc.). I completely understand wanting to show dinosaurs in their heyday as opposed to looking back on them with the knowledge of their extinction looming, but I wanted to see so much more from Darren Naish and company talking about recent discoveries and the nuances of their recreations. (This obviously has more to do with the behind-the-scenes featurettes than the episodes themselves, but all of this is to say, bring on the paleontologists!)
